How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Vancouver?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Vancouver Pet Friendly Studio Apartments | $1,501 | $989 | $2,549 |
| Vancouver Pet Friendly 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,710 | $630 | $4,869 |
| Vancouver Pet Friendly 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,947 | $751 | $6,471 |
| Vancouver Pet Friendly 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,328 | $1,459 | $4,248 |
| Vancouver Pet Friendly 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,307 | $1,902 | $2,766 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Vancouver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Vancouver?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Vancouver is at The Hudson listed at $1,057.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Vancouver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Vancouver is $1,892.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Vancouver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Vancouver is a 4,000 square feet unit starting from $1,600 at Yacht Harbor Club.
What is the average size for Vancouver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Vancouver is currently at 706 sq ft.
